Toggle Inventory and Container Views 🧪
It is possible to toggle between different item views, based on which view suits your needs best or which one you prefer.
The available views are:
- List view shows the contents as a list, with global ID information
- Tree view enables you to navigate a nested hierarchy of items
- Card view is useful for viewing image, location, content, and modified details at a glance
- Grid view enables you to view items as located in a two-dimensional grid
- Visual view enables you to view items as located on an image
The different views are described in more detail below.

View types
The left-hand panel and all containers support list, tree, and card views.
Additionally, grid containers support grid view, and visual containers support visual view.
List
List view shows the contents as a list, with their global ID information. It is useful for performing bulk actions using the item checkboxes (see Edit a Sample or Container), and for viewing search results.

Tree
Tree view enables you to navigate a nested hierarchy of items. Click on a container to expand or collapse its contents; clicking on an item also opens it in the right-hand panel.

You can use the Navigate To Container button to zoom your view into that container's contents.

You can use the sort toggle to sort the results by Name (A-Z or Z-A) or Type (A-Z or Z-A).

Card
Card view is useful for viewing image, location, content, and modified details at a glance. Clicking on a card opens it in the right-hand panel. Similarly to tree view, you have a sorting toggle to sort results by Name or by Type.

Grid
Grid view is only available for grid containers. It enables you to view items as located in a two-dimensional grid. You can read more at Select Items in a Container and Customise Axis Labels for Grid Containers.

Visual
Visual view is only available for visual containers. It enables you to view items as located on an image. You can read more at Select Items in a Container.
